Created by Alfred Wainwright, the Coast to Coast Walk crosses the breadth of the North of England from St Bees on the west coast to Robin Hood’s Bay on the east coast. Some of the most varied and beautiful scenery in the country lies ahead, spread over three National Parks.
Wainwright’s Coast to Coast Walk clambers the rugged mountains of the Lake District to earn views over glittering tarns. It winds through the pretty valleys of the Yorkshire Dales and sets out across the expansive heather moorland of the North York Moors. Dramatic coastal scenery waits at the end, with a twisting descent to Robin Hood’s Bay.

At long last, this well-known walking holiday is on its way to recognition as a National Trail. The work is still in progress, but anyone walking the Coast to Coast will notice brand-new waymarkers going in, complete with the National Trail acorn. The west section of the Coast to Coast Walk traverses the Lake District National Park from the cliffs of St Bees Head to the old market town of Kirkby Stephen. The Lake District features rugged fells and quiet valleys filled with wildlife, offering variety and intrigue at every turn.
Each town and village along the route boasts its own unique charm and history. Some locations of note include the impressive priory church of St Mary and St Bega in St Bees, and the ‘bound devil’ found in St Stephen’s Church in Kirkby Stephen.
